Shula's offers great steaks, but falls short in other key areas. The blue point oysters (a rare find on Tampa menus) were great, but the salads and side dishes were disappointing. We would prefer better quality instead of quantity, especially at these prices. The bernaise sauce is terrible, and they burned the souffle. The bread is very good, but at $100 a person, the entire meal should be outstanding, not bits and pieces. Ruth's Chris is more consistent. Room is small and cramped. Service was very slow two times we have been in last year.
Pros: Good steaks, Blue point oysters, masculine/sport atmos
Cons: mediocre salad/sides, VERY expensive, cramped/slow service
